Verdict

Green Bay and Sheboygan are closely matched on overall dialysis technician compensation, each winning on different metrics.

The salary gap between Green Bay and Sheboygan is $1,640 (3.69%). Sheboygan's median is +1.75% compared to the US national median of $45,322.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Sheboygan ($49,051 effective) pays 2.66% more than Green Bay ($47,778 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, dialysis technician salaries in Green Bay grew 14.7% from 2021 to 2025, compared to -3.5% growth in Sheboygan over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 2.41%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
